“Lebanese President Joseph Aoun on Thursday ordered the armed forces to oppose any Israeli incursions in the country’s south following an Israeli raid that killed a municipal worker. Aoun ordered the army to ‘confront any Israeli incursion into liberated southern territory, in defence of Lebanese territory and the safety of citizens,’ during a meeting with the army chief, according to a statement from the presidency. Despite a November 2024 ceasefire with Lebanese militant group Hezbollah, Israel maintains troops in five areas in southern Lebanon and has kept up regular air strikes, which have recently intensified.” (10/30/25)
